What was the National Origins Act of 1924?

The National Origins Act of 1924 was a law that discriminated against immigrants by limiting the amount of immigrants that could enter the US from South and Eastern Europe. The National Origins Act remained in effect until the 1960's.


What reactant gives the lowest yield by limiting the amount of product?

A reactant that gives the lowest yield by limiting the amount of product is called a limiting reactant. The limiting reactant will run out, so that only a limited amount of product can be made from the reactants.

Why is limiting reactants important in stoichiometry?

Limiting reactants are the reactants that are used up first. And once they are used up, they stop, or limit, the reaction. So the amount of product that can be produced depends on the limiting reactant. The other reactant, the one in excess, would predict a larger amount of product. But once we produce the amount of product predicted by the limiting reactant. The limiting reactant is used up and the reaction stops.
